Output ab1445332de31c2a5aa94aeb0c774eb747ca2651190523606f569323669853fb:3

value
32096175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f58f24423b813e57ce8d59f8783af0a4445c40e OP_EQUAL
address
361NEfGnPTmZWW9vzd5913qbFr3kSuVv1k
transaction
ab1445332de31c2a5aa94aeb0c774eb747ca2651190523606f569323669853fb
spent
true